Built a Windows-based automation system to monitor and control safety-critical rigging machines in real time, featuring live status, diagnostics, and a cue-based engine for precise, synchronized multi-machine motion

A healthcare-focused transport system designed for a medical clinic to provide safe, door-to-door rides for elderly patients. The application supports patients, drivers, and administrators with controlled access and role-based workflows. Core features include trip scheduling, route guidance, and driver assignment to ensure reliable transportation to medical appointments. The system improves coordination between clinic staff, drivers, and patients to streamline daily medical transport operations.
